According to the Journal of Patient Safety as many as 440,000 people are killed each year in the United States by preventable medical errors. That number is equivalent to almost the population of Atlanta. Preventable medical errors are the third leading cause of death in the United States. When a health care professional’s negligence results in serious injury, victims often suffer long-term physical, emotional, and financial damages.

Medical malpractice exists when a physician or another health care professional fails to do something in treating a patient that they should have done or when they do something that a reasonably careful, similarly licensed professional would not do. Medical negligence exists when a health care provider fails to do what a similarly licensed, reasonably careful provider would have done in the same scenario. Some examples of medical malpractice and negligence include:

  • Nursing Home Neglect/Elder Abuse
  • Failure to Diagnose/Misdiagnosis
  • Hospital Mistakes and Negligence
  • Birth Injury
  • Surgical Injuries
  • Wrongful death

Hospital Mistakes and Negligence

According to a recent Institute of Medicine report, hospital mistakes account for 48 percent of medical malpractice claims. The study concludes that roughly 70 percent of these medical errors are preventable. The report lists the causes of errors as:

  • Technical errors – 44 percent
  • Misdiagnosis – 17 percent
  • Failure to prevent injury – 12 percent
  • Medication errors – 10 percent

Common hospital mistakes that could lead to serious injury or wrongful death include: medication errors, surgical errors, and obstetrical mistakes. Negligence occurs when a hospital does not follow proper safety precautions or fails to provide basic care. Surgical Injuries

All surgeries carry a degree of risk or the possibility of error. However, sometimes avoidable errors may be made in the administration of surgery. These errors include:

  • Surgical site mistakes
  • Blood type mistakes
  • Infections caused by surgery
  • Surgical instruments left inside the patient’s body
  • Wrong patient mistakes
  • Anesthesia mistakes

Failure to Diagnose/Misdiagnosis

One of the most costly medical errors, failure to diagnose or misdiagnosis leads to delayed, omitted, or inappropriate medical treatments. According to an Institute of Medicine study error rates range from 1.4 percent in cancer biopsies to a 20 to 40 percent in emergency room or ICU care.

Birth Injury

Birth injuries are physical injuries or deformities that are the direct result of childbirth. Studies show nearly three percent of American babies suffer birth defects. These injuries, often avoidable, can result in lifetime disability or deformity.

Common Birth Injuries Include:

  • Cerebral palsy
  • Brain or spinal cord damage
  • Oxygen deprivation
  • Bone fractures
  • Mental retardation
  • Bruising and skin irritation
  • Erb’s palsy
  • Paralysis
  • Klumpke’s palsy Infections
  • Brachial plexus
  • Internal bleeding
  • Injury due to forceps
  • Wrongful death
